Department stores have already begun the back-to-school sales, grab the catalogues and work out which store has the overall best deals and write a list of what you need so you don't buy unnecessary items. Your list can be collated from the book-list the school has provided; you may find that some items don't need to be purchased again as they will still be in good condition from the year before. Most importantly, don't forget a lock for your locker!

One good tip is to always place a couple of $2 coins in your backpack; this is great for emergencies, like forgetting your bus money or lunch or if something else happens. You may also find it very helpful to have your bag packed, lunch organised and clothes laid out the night before- this way there will be no rush in the morning.

If you have troubles remembering your homework always write a 'to-do' list in your diary, this way you won't forget anything needed for school.

For a fantastic year it is important to set yourself goals that you can work at achieving over the year. Your goals could be participating in school activities like sports and music or achieving good marks or even being on time to school every day for the whole school year.
